How to fill out an ordinance creating section

How to fill out an ordinance creating section
01
To fill out an ordinance creating section, follow these steps:
02
Start by clearly identifying the purpose and objective of the ordinance.
03
Include a title for the section that accurately reflects its content.
04
Provide a brief introduction or preamble that explains the need for the ordinance and its intended impact.
05
Specify the scope and applicability of the ordinance, including any relevant jurisdictions or areas of enforcement.
06
Clearly define the key terms or definitions used throughout the section to avoid confusion.
07
Enumerate the specific provisions or regulations that the ordinance will impose.
08
Provide detailed instructions or guidelines on how to comply with the ordinance.
09
Include any necessary penalties or consequences for non-compliance.
10
Consider including provisions for monitoring, enforcement, and reporting.
11
Ensure the ordinance is clear, concise, and easily understandable by the target audience.
12
Review and revise the section for accuracy, consistency, and legal compliance.
13
Obtain any required approvals or authorizations before finalizing the ordinance.
14
Publish and distribute the ordinance to relevant stakeholders or affected parties.
15
Periodically review and update the ordinance as needed to reflect changing circumstances or legal requirements.
